El Paseo de Rosie is the Spanish Edition of Pat Hutchins' Rosie's Walk, illustrated by Alma Flor Ada.
The Fox is after Rosie, but Rosie doesn't know it. Unwittingly, she leads him into one disaster after other, each funnier than the last. To enjoy Rosie's walk as much as Rosie, does, just look inside!

About the Author
Pat Hutchins is the author and illustrator of many popular picture books, including Rosie’s Walk; Good-Night, Owl!; Titch; and The Wind Blew, for which she won the Kate Greenaway Medal. She lives in London, England.
Alma Flor Ada, an authority on multicultural and bilingual education, is the recipient of the 2012 Virginia Hamilton Literary Award, and in 2014 she was honored by the Mexican government with the prestigious OHTLI Award. She is the author of numerous award-winning books for young readers, including Dancing Home with Gabriel Zubizarreta, My Name Is María Isabel, Under the Royal Palms (Pura Belpré Medal), Where the Flame Trees Bloom, and The Gold Coin (Christopher Award Medal). She lives in California, and you can visit her at AlmaFlorAda.com.
